0

CSS で奇妙な問題が発生しています。@chriscoyier のコードを SMACSS アプローチを使用してリファクタリングし、モジュール化しました。

.ribbon.green を CSS の一番下に移動すると、適用されません。これは、ribbon:after & リボン:before と関係がありますか?

それをボタンに移動すると、jsFiddle では正常に機能するようですが、Firefox や Chrome では機能しないようです。 http://jsfiddle.net/SkinnyGeek1010/cDWKe/1/

なぜこれを行うのかについてのアイデアはありますか?とにかく.ribbon.greenを一番下に移動することはありますか? これにより、ミックスインで「スキン」を簡単に変更できます。

** ドロップボックス html を追加 **
http://dl.dropbox.com/u/1407764/www/stackoverflow/corner-ribbon/green_ribbon_example.html

4

1 に答える 1

0

私はそれをテストしました。.ribbon.green を下に移動しても問題なく動作しています。他のルールと競合する可能性があります。

于 2012-02-18T17:15:54.343 に答える